(Pennisetum setaceum 'Rubrum') Sometimes called Purple Fountain Grass, this favorite grows to 5 to 7 feet - or buy the dwarf variety that only gets 3 to 4 feet tall. Dark maroon-red ribbon-like leaves are topped with with purple-beige plumes. This plant is great in full to partial sun.

Fountain grass is a mounding, clumping herbaceous grass in the Poaceae family that grows 2-4' tall and is normally grown as an annual. This plant starts blooming in summer and those flowers last until frost attracting birds.
